What does Athant mean?

The name Athant is derived from the Sanskrit language. It is a name of reverence, denoting purity and a connection to the Brahmin caste. The name carries a deep spiritual significance and is often given to boys in Hindu communities.

Spiritual & cultural context

Connected to the divine and pure in spirit.

The name Athant holds a significant cultural impact in the Hindu tradition, as it has strong roots in the Brahmin caste, which is considered the highest in the Indian social hierarchy. The name is derived from Sanskrit, a language that encompasses a vast body of learning, literature, and religious wisdom. In India, the Brahmin caste has historically been associated with knowledge, priesthood, and scholarly pursuits. The Sanskrit root of the name implies a connection to the ancient wisdom of Hinduism and a respect for its rich intellectual heritage. Naming a boy Athant can signify his potential to uphold these values and contribute to the preservation of Indian culture and knowledge.
